# Cutoff rule constants for the Millbarrow bakery scheduler.
#
# These values gate when customer orders lock for next-day production.
# Changing any of them shifts the overnight proofing window, so they
# must move in lockstep with the oven-crew roster in Hearthplan.
# Do not hotfix these in a release branch without a matching roster
# update. The constants, in the order the scheduler reads them, follow.

limits module of fajog-tawig:
RATE_LIMITS = {
    "druwyn": 2,
    "quenael": 10,
    "wenix": 2,
    "druael": 2,
}

## Prototype Transport — Vellan Labs Run

Driver collects one padded case from Orrick Systems, Building C, dock 2. Case stays sealed; no stacking, no transfer between vehicles. Destination is the Vellan test lab intake window, weekdays only. Coordinator confirms departure and arrival by radio check. At the intake window, the driver follows this hand-over instruction word for word.

handover note for yagef-bagep: the drudor pelius courier leaves the kasdor zorvan norir ledger at gate 8016 under passcode 755406

Action item from the Kestrelboard postmortem: bulk edits in the admin table bypassed row-level validation, letting an operator null out 4k records in one pass. Fix ships in 3.2: batch size caps, per-row validation, and a mandatory dry-run preview. Release manager should hold the train until staging replay passes. The guardrails below are what the dry-run enforces.

limits module of tafop-hahop:
WEIGHTS = {
    "julmir": 223,
    "belox": 987,
    "lamion": 470,
    "pelath": 609,
    "fraok": 1010,
    "eliion": 343,
    "drudor": 342,
}

Keyturner is our internal secrets-rotation utility. It rotates database credentials, service tokens, and signing material on a fixed schedule, writing new values to the Vaultern store and grace-expiring old ones after 24 hours. Most day-to-day use is just `keyturner status` and `keyturner rotate --dry-run`; the scheduler handles the rest. Before you run a manual rotation, read up on grace windows and the consumer-refresh ordering, since rotating out of order can briefly strand a service. The full operator guide is on the page below.

runbook for badug-kadup: https://confluence.zemvarlabs.internal/projects/browse/display/projects/bd1b